Zirconium Tube Rod Market
The global zirconium tube and rod market is experiencing significant expansion, primarily fueled by the increasing need for high-performance materials in sectors that demand resistance to corrosion, heat, and pressure. Zirconium’s exceptional properties—such as high tensile strength, thermal stability, low neutron absorption, and outstanding resistance to chemical corrosion—make it a critical material for use in nuclear reactors, chemical processing systems, defense components, and medical-grade implants. The nuclear industry continues to be a dominant consumer of zirconium tubes and rods, as zirconium alloys are essential for cladding nuclear fuel rods due to their ability to withstand extreme heat and radiation while maintaining structural integrity. With the rise in global interest in nuclear power as a clean and efficient energy source, especially in response to climate change and fossil fuel limitations, the demand for zirconium products is accelerating. Meanwhile, the chemical industry relies on zirconium for equipment like reactors, condensers, and heat exchangers that must resist strong acids and alkaline conditions. In aerospace and marine engineering, zirconium rods are used in environments where conventional metals would corrode or fail over time, especially in propulsion systems, structural supports, and tubing for fluid transfer. In the medical field, zirconium’s biocompatibility and non-toxic nature have made it a preferred choice for use in joint replacements, dental implants, and surgical tools. These applications reflect a growing reliance on zirconium tubes and rods as industries pursue stronger, safer, and more durable materials to meet the demands of modern engineering and innovation.
From a geographic standpoint, Asia-Pacific remains the most dominant region in the zirconium tube and rod market, driven by massive investments in infrastructure, clean energy, and industrial expansion. China leads the region not only as the largest producer but also as a major end-user, supported by its aggressive rollout of nuclear power projects and its expansive chemical manufacturing sector. India is also ramping up demand through its nuclear energy ambitions and a rapidly modernizing industrial landscape. Countries like Japan and South Korea continue to play pivotal roles due to their advanced technological capabilities and significant consumption in electronics, aerospace, and medical industries. North America, led by the United States, holds a strong position in the global market owing to its reliance on nuclear power, robust defense sector, and cutting-edge medical and aerospace industries that demand specialized materials. In Europe, countries like Germany, France, and the UK maintain consistent demand for zirconium tubes and rods, with applications spanning across nuclear energy, precision machinery, pharmaceuticals, and renewable technologies. These developed markets are also placing a growing emphasis on sustainability and advanced materials, which favors the continued use of zirconium-based components. Latin America and the Middle East & Africa are emerging players, gradually adopting zirconium for infrastructure, water treatment, and petrochemical applications as industrial capabilities expand.
